Output 2d91cd4716d01d19436f945aee423ab21c2868a53bbc03019771889344b66969:20

value
2000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5de6025bd3e53260d0c94704d68ee28da1463194 OP_EQUAL
address
3AFWJhob597439fs5aJn4p298LkCrUzdFA
transaction
2d91cd4716d01d19436f945aee423ab21c2868a53bbc03019771889344b66969
spent
true